【摩根大通要求所有分析师强制学Python: 不懂编程就是文盲】教程文章相关的互联网学习教程文章

Python 爬虫进阶必备 | 某工业超市加密 header 参数分析【图】

今日网站aHR0cHM6Ly93ZWIuemtoMzYwLmNvbS9saXN0L2MtMjYwMTg2Lmh0bWw/c2hvd1R5cGU9cGljJmNscD0x这个网站是在某交流群看到的,随手保存下来作为今天的素材抓包分析与加密定位先看看抓包的结果,可以看到请求的header中包含两个未知的参数,分别是zkhs和zkhst进一步检索参数zkhst和zkhs,可以发现这两个参数的值没有做过混淆并且都有对应的搜索结果可以在文件中找到下面这几个关键位置加密分析在逻辑里比较明显的是e.headers.zkhs?=?o...

打开我的收藏夹 -- Python数据分析杂谈【代码】【图】

文章目录 玩转json什么是jsonPython中的Json模块获取json中的某个数据 Jpath numpy使用ndarray创建数组的好处numpy基本操作 文本数据去重数据采集方式好几天没写啥实在的干货了,今天见六不废话了,直接上干货。玩转json 什么是json Json是一种轻量级的数据交换格式,具有数据格式简单,读写方便易懂等很多优点。用它来进行前后端的数据传输,大大的简化了服务器和客户端的开发工作量。 如果说现在对json还没有什么概念的朋友,了解...

【数值分析】python实现复化辛普森积分【代码】【图】

python代码 import numpy as npa, b = input("积分区间:").split(' ') n = int(input("子区间个数:"))a = int(a) b = int(b) x_i = np.linspace(a, b, n+1) # 区间结点 h = (b-a)/n# 原函数 def f(x):return 4/(1+x**2)def piece(x_i, i, h): return h/6 * (f(x_i[i-1]) + 4*f((x_i[i-1] + x_i[i])/2) + f(x_i[i]))S = 0 for i in range(1, n+1):S = S + piece(x_i, i, h)print("复化辛普森积分公式计算结果:" + str(S))输入格式...

Python数据分析相关面试题!Python学习教程

数据分析是Python的就业方向之一,近年来,伴随着国内互联网发展,数据分析开始崭露头角,因此很多开发者都因为薪资和发展前景转行从事数据分析工作。那么你知道如何找到满意的数据分析岗吗?今天小编就跟大家来聊聊有关Python数据分析师面试的问题。  例举几个常用的Python分析数据包  数据处理和分析:numpy、scipy、pandas;  机器学习:scikit;  可视化:matplotlib、seaborn。  如何利用numpy对数列的前N项进行排序? ...

如何去使用Python分析股票数据?学到就是赚到【图】

对于炒股的同学来说,必须会看懂数据才能避免入坑。今天小千就来教大家如何去使用Python分析股票数据,学到就是赚到。(小千提醒,股市有风险,请谨慎投资) 这次的美股例子就选择了美国显卡制造商英伟达,其股票代码是NVDA,熟悉英伟达的人都知道他们的CEO老黄(Jensen Huang),老黄有两样东西很出名,一是那件能穿4个季度的皮衣,二是精湛的显卡刀法。英伟达在老黄带领下飞速发展,其股价也是一直飙升,所以选择这个股票也...

javalang 生成抽象语法树AST ----python源码分析【代码】【图】

维基百科中说: 在计算机科学中,抽象语法树(Abstract Syntax Tree,AST),或简称语法树(Syntax tree),是源代码语法结构的一种抽象表示。它以树状的形式表现编程语言的语法结构,树上的每个节点都表示源代码中的一种结构。之所以说语法是“抽象”的,是因为这里的语法并不会表示出真实语法中出现的每个细节。比如,嵌套括号被隐含在树的结构中,并没有以节点的形式呈现;而类似于 if-condition-then 这样的条件跳转语...

Python爬虫系列之抓取爱淘宝网并简单分析商品数据【图】

前言 相信说起“淘宝” ,大家都不会感到陌生吧。作为中国最大的电商平台,淘宝仿佛已经与我们的生活紧密相连。今天就让我们随便愉快地利用Python爬取并简单分析爱淘宝网商品数据。 开发工具 Python版本:3.6.4 相关模块: numpy模块; seaborn模块; requests模块; pyecharts模块; pandas模块; matplotlib模块; wordcloud模块; scipy模块; 以及一些Python自带的模块。 环境搭建 安装Python并添加到环境变量,pip安装需要的相...

Python数据分析入门(一):搭建环境【代码】【图】

Python版本: 本课程用到的Python版本都是3.x。要有一定的Python基础,知道列表、字符串、函数等的用法。 Anaconda: Anaconda(水蟒)是一个捆绑了Python、conda、其他相关依赖包的一个软件。包含了180多个可学计算包及其依赖。Anaconda3是集成了Python3的环境,Anaconda2是集成了Python2的环境。Anaconda默认集成的包,是属于内置的Python的包。并且支持绝大部分操作系统(比如:Windows、Mac、Linux等)。下载地址如下:https:/...

python数据分析 Lending Club贷款数据【代码】【图】

目录 sample() 随机抽样函数选取指定数据merge数据连接融合join数据连接融合对指定属性排序删除某列并对缺失值进行处理strip去除%使用to_numeric将字符串转化为数值型使用cut与qcut将某变量离散化 分割使用replace与map对变量进行值替换get_dummies进行哑变量处理一.sample() 随机抽样函数 loan.sample(n=3,axis=1,random_state=1,replace=True) #n=3 随即查看3列(默认为行) #axis=1可实现列采样 #random_state有时,我们希望重...

python量化分析日记【代码】

作为无基础的初学者,只想先大概了解一下Python,随便编个小程序,并能看懂一般的程序,那些什么JAVA啊、C啊、继承啊、异常啊通通不懂怎么办,于是我找了很多资料,写成下面这篇日记,希望以完全初学者的角度入手来认识Python这个在量化领域日益重要的语言 ###一,熟悉基本 在正式介绍python之前,了解下面两个基本操作对后面的学习是有好处的: 1)基本的输入输出可以在Python中使用+、-、*、/直接进行四则运算。1+3*3 复制代码 1...

Python系列爬虫之抓取并分析51job招聘数据【图】

前言 之前发Python爬取并分析拉勾网招聘数据的时候似乎有人让我爬爬其他地方的招聘数据,那么今天给大家爬取下51job招聘数据 开发工具 Python版本:3.6.4 相关模块: requests模块; pyecharts模块; 以及一些Python自带的模块。 环境搭建 安装Python并添加到环境变量,pip安装需要的相关模块即可。 数据爬取 #####(1)思路 我们要爬取的目标数据是这些:获取数据的链接格式为: https://search.51job.com/list/000000,000000,000...

Python和Java哪个好?分析!

Python和Java哪个好?我想很多人转行学习编程语言的时候都会被这个问题所困扰。Java和Python是当下非常火的编程语言,需求量大、就业薪资高、发展前景好,那么到底该选择哪个呢?  Java是一门资深的编程语言,普及率高,有着丰富的第三方库,Java拥有庞大的市场需求量,从web开发、网络开发、App开发到云计算应用,都可以利用Java来实现,是典型的面向对象的开发语言;不过Java开发代码不简洁、开发效率较低、学习时间成本比较高、难...

从事Python数据分析师,必须掌握的Python工具!

在我们的生活中,Python语言可谓是无处不在,能够应用在各大领域之中,比如说数据分析师,Python在数据分析领域有着非常不错的表现,想要从事数据分析师,掌握Python是非常有必要的。接下来为大家介绍几个数据分析师必须具备的Python工具!  1、Pandas:是一个开源的,BSD许可的库,为Python编程语言提供高性能,易于使用的数据结构和数据分析工具,Python长期以来非常适合数据整理和准备,但是对于数据分析和建模不那么重要,Pan...

Python数据分析入门到实战

点击下载——Python数据分析入门到实战 提取码: fce9点击下载——Python数据分析入门到实战 密码:quhrjw适用人群1、想学习数据分析的。2、想利用Python做数据分析的。3、想做数据可视化的。章节1:第一天:数据分析入门章节2:第二天:Numpy数据处理库(1)章节3:第三天:Numpy数据处理库(2)章节4:第四天:Pandas库数据处理库(1)章节5:第五天:Pandas数据处理库(2)章节6:第六天:Pandas数据处理库(3)章节7:第七天:Pandas数...

世界500强公司面试题——台阶问题的分析与Python实现 原创 王帅

问题描述:假设有一座高度是30级台阶的楼梯,从下往上走,每跨一步只能向上1级或者2级台阶。要求用程序来求出一共有多少种走法。 分析问题:如果每次走一步,则需要走40步;如果每次走两步,则需要走20步;走一步和走两步可以有交叉,那么总共有多少种呢? 这时我们先假设台阶数为1,则方法只有一种,F(1) = 1;假设台阶数为2,则可行的走法为(1,1)和(2) 共两种 F(2) =2;假设台阶数为3,则可行的走法为(1,1,1),(2,1),(1,2) 共三种 F...